Equipment
Handheld Mixer or Stand Mixer
Ingredients
Liquid brine drained from 2 cans of chickpeas
¼heaping teaspoon of Cream of Tartar
2teaspoonsvanilla extractcould could also add additional almond extract
1cupwhite sugarfinely ground
Instructions
Drain the liquid from the cans of chickpeas. Add the Cream of Tartar and mix together. Then add the vanilla and sugar and mix together for 10 to 15 minutes using a stand mixer or handheld mixer. The aquafaba should fluff up and the peaks should hold—then you know you're done!

Notes
This makes a giant batch—but you can easily halve the recipe.
The aquafaba should be served soon after it is made (within a few hours). If you refrigerate it overnight, it will turn back into a liquid. You can re-whip it again and again though!
Don't use a single-blade immersion blender—this won't work.
